About

Haytham Elmiligi is a scholar working on Computer Networks and Communications, Electrical and Electronic Engineering and Hardware and Architecture. According to data from OpenAlex, Haytham Elmiligi has authored 45 papers receiving a total of 469 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 30 papers in Computer Networks and Communications, 17 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ering and 16 papers in Hardware and Architecture. Recurrent topics in Haytham Elmiligi's work include Interconnection Networks and Systems (20 papers), Embedded Systems Design Techniques (12 papers) and Supercapacitor Materials and Fabrication (7 papers). Haytham Elmiligi is often cited by papers focused on Interconnection Networks and Systems (20 papers), Embedded Systems Design Techniques (12 papers) and Supercapacitor Materials and Fabrication (7 papers). Haytham Elmiligi collaborates with scholars based in Canada, Egypt and India. Haytham Elmiligi's co-authors include Fayez Gebali, M. Watheq El‐Kharashi, Sherif Saad, Luis Rueda, David Hill, Seyed Mehdi Hazrati Fard, Abhishek Verma, Ali Alzahrani, Jens Weber and Gloria Ramírez and has published in prestigious journals such as Sensors, International Journal of Remote Sensing and Diagnostics.
